Product Information
The MC1.25KW Quad Balanced Power Amplifier is one of McIntosh’s most advanced amplifiers. Redesigned from top to bottom, it replaces the venerable MC1.2KW as their most powerful single chassis monoblock amplifier. A simple glance at this 158 pound amp is enough to convey its power and performance capabilities, but when you hear it – then you’ll truly understand what it can do.

75th Anniversary Edition
The McIntosh MC1.25KW 75th Anniversary Edition’s top panel is adorned with a dual-anodized, laser-engraved 75th Anniversary badge, giving it a distinctive commemorative identity. Each front handle is also engraved with “75 Years,” adding a collector-grade touch that visually distinguishes it from the standard model. Beyond these enhancements, the amplifier retains the same 1,200-watt Autoformer™ power, iconic blue watt meter, Quad Balanced circuitry, and protection technologies that define the MC1.25KW’s performance. The result is a limited-edition version that delivers the same world-class sound while offering elevated aesthetics and long-term collectible appeal.
Power Output & Autoformer™ Performance
The MC1.25KW outputs 1,200 Watts of pure power into a single channel with a nearly imperceptible total harmonic distortion of 0.005%. This astonishing amount of power is fully available to 2, 4 or 8 Ohm speakers via our Autoformer™ technology. A pair of these amps can anchor a home audio system that can rival nearly any stereo system in the world.
Design Updates & Performance Enhancements
Updates and enhancements abound in the MC1.25KW. A 50% increase in filter capacity improves the performance of low end frequencies as well as increasing dynamic headroom. The top of the amp showcases an updated yet unmistakable McIntosh industrial design that will fit right in with current McIntosh products or those made decades ago. The audio Autoformer and power transformer remain located just behind the front panel but are now contained in new glass topped enclosures. In between them is new circular glasswork housing the amplifier’s name badge that is adorned with a decorative trim ring.
Monogrammed Heatsinks™ & Thermal Performance
The rear of the unit features 4 of our McIntosh Monogrammed Heatsinks™. Made from high quality materials with excellent thermal conductivity properties, these heatsinks are so efficient at dissipating heat that they warrant bearing the McIntosh “Mc” logo. They connect to advanced high current output transistors that eliminate thermal equilibrium lag time so that the first musical note played sounds just as good as songs played later in your listening session.
Chassis, Power Handling, & Structural Refinements
The AC receptacle has been repositioned to provide additional clearance so a wider assortment of power cords can more easily be used. All of this sits atop a polished stainless steel chassis which rests on 4 new redesigned feet that feature a chamfered edge. Other updates include an updated power transformer, heavier gauge internal wiring, upgraded circuit components, and the addition of our power management system that will turn the amp off after a set amount of time when no input signal has been detected.
Front Panel, Metering, & Aesthetic Elements
With all the changes and improvements made in the MC1.25KW, one thing that hasn’t changed is the large, fast responding 11” blue Watt meter that accurately shows the amp’s power output. Also unchanged is the signature black glass front panel with control knobs, illuminated logo, and aluminum end caps with handles. The front panel and meter have new direct LED backlighting for improved appearance and color accuracy.
Power Guard®
Power Guard® that monitors and adjusts the output signal at the speed of light and makes real time adjustments to prevent harsh sounding and potentially speaker damaging clipping
Sentry Monitor™
McIntosh’s fuse-less short-circuit protection circuit that disengages the output stage before current exceeds safe operating levels and then resets automatically when operating conditions return to normal.
Specifications
- Power output per channel: 1200W @ 2, 4, or 8 ohms
- Number of channels: 1
- Total harmonic distortion: 0.005%
- S/N below rated output: 124dB
- Dynamic headroom: 2.1dB
- Damping factor: > 40 wideband
- Rated power band: 20Hz to 20kHz
- Frequency response
- +0, -0.25dB from 20Hz to 20,000Hz
- +0, -3dB from 10Hz to 100,000Hz
- Remote power control: Yes
- Circuit configuration: Quad balanced
- Circuit design: Transistor
- Autoformer: Yes
- Meters: Yes
- Meter light switch: Yes
- Balanced input: Yes-2
- Front panel: 1/2" glass with handles
- Illumination: LED fiber optic
- Chassis style: Open stainless steel
- Speaker binding post type: Yes, 200 amp, 3-way
- Dimensions (W x H x D): 17 3/4" x 12 5/16" x 22"
- Weight: 147 lbs.
